Arianna is buying plants for her garden. she buys 15 flowering plants for $96. pink flowering plants sell for $8, and purple flowering plants sell for $5. how many pink flowering plants did arianna buy? i figured out the answer! the answer is 7. 8x +5y = 96 plug in 7 for x 8 (7) + 5y = 96 56 + 5y = 96 subtract 56 from both sides 5y/y = 40/5 y = 8 she bought 7 pink and 8 purple plants
